Murraywood Construction takes on new social values project in Blackpool

After we found out the Donna’s Dream House charity was based right outside the Blackpool Multi-Storey Car Park site, we knew we wanted to do something to help.

The charity is a holiday home for children and teenagers with life threatening and terminal illnesses to visit with their families to take a break from hospital and treatment or to spend their remaining days making memories by the beach.

We went to visit the holiday home and discovered their car park needed some attention which we wanted to help with.

This isn’t something we were told to do, it’s something we felt had to be done to give back to the local community, like we strive to do on every site we complete works on.

In the summer of 2022, some volunteers reduce levelled the footpath area and did the formwork shutters for the concrete slab before Murraywood Construction installed steel reinforcement and supplied concrete with a float finish and a brush affect to stop slips, trips and falls in the winter.

Apprentice bricklayers from the local college are going to build a brick wall to stop people from parking to block the pedestrian footpath.

We are set to go back in the spring of 2023 to jet wash the area and re-brush kiln dried sand.
